It's finally happened. On Super Bowl Sunday, Kylie Jenner announced she was pregnant, and get this, she's already given birth. E! Online has confirmed the news. The 20-year-old broke her social media silence to announce that she gave birth to a baby girl on Feb. 1. The news comes on the same day that many speculated Jenner's boyfriend, Travis Scott, cancelled his Super Bowl weekend show to be close just in case Jenner went into labor this weekend. However, it now seems more likely that if Jenner factored into the cancellation, it had to do with him wanting to be around the new baby. Meanwhile, Jenner's fans are shook by the star's lengthy confirmation of her baby's birth.

Jenner's official Twitter announcement reads:

"I'm sorry for keeping you in the dark through all of the assumptions. I understand you're used to me bringing you along on all my journeys. My pregnancy was one I chose not to do in front of the world. I knew for myself I needed to prepare for this role of a lifetime in the most positive, stress free, and healthy way I knew how. There was no gotcha moment, no big paid reveal I had planned. I knew my baby would feel every stress and every emotion so I chose to do it this way for my little life and our happiness.
Pregnancy has been the most beautiful, empowering, and life-changing experience I've had in my entire life, and I'm actually going to miss it. I appreciate my friends and especially my family for helping me make this special moment as private as we could. My beautiful and healthy baby girl arrived February 1st and I just couldn't wait to share this blessing. I've never felt love and happiness like this. I could burst! Thank you for understanding."
